4 - ALARM 

With these settings, it is determined how the flow rate will be monitored and the functionality of the transistor outputs be deter-
mined. 

ALARM 
4.1 

Setting the function of the Alarm  
The following settings can be selected: 
Off: 

Function disabled. 

Operate: 

Full function of the low flow alarm. 

Hidden:  

Does not display alarms on LCD. 

ALARM VALUE 
ZERO 
4.2 

The Zero alarm is set with this setting. An alarm will be generated as long as there is no flow rate. 
Select Off to disable 

ALARM VALUE 
LOW 
4.3 

The low alarm is set with this setting. An alarm will be generated as long as the flow rate is lower 
than this. 
With value 0.0 this function is disabled. 

ALARM VALUE 
HIGH 
4.4 

The high alarm is set with this setting. An alarm will be generated as long as the flow rate is higher 
than this. 
With value 0.0 this function is disabled. 

DELAY TIME ALARM 
4.5 

This function allows a delay period before the alarm is activated 0—99 seconds. 

6 - ANALOG OUTPUT 

A linear analog (0)4-20mA signal is generated according to the flow rate with a 10 bits resolution. The settings for flow rate 
(SETUP - 2) influence the analog output directly. 
The relationship between rate and analog output is set with the following functions: 

MINIMUM FLOWRATE 
6.1 

Enter here the flowrate at which the output should generate the minimum  signal (0/4mA or 0V) - in 
most applications at flow rate "zero". 
The number of decimals displayed depend upon SETUP 23. 
The time and measuring units (L/min for example) are dependant upon SETUP 21 and 22 but are 
not displayed. 

MAXIMUM FLOWRATE 
6.2 

Enter here the flow rate at which the output should generate the maximum signal (20mA or 10V) - 
in most applications at maximum flow. 
The number of decimals displayed depend upon SETUP 23. 
The time and measuring units (L/min for example) are dependant upon SETUP 21 and 22 but can 
not be displayed. 

TUNE MIN / 4MA 
6.3 

The initial minimum analog output value is 4mA . However, this value might differ slightly due to 
external influences such as temperature for example. The 4mA value can be tuned precisely with 
this setting. 

Before tuning the signal, be sure that the analog signal is not being used for any 

application! 

After pressing PROG, the current will be about 4mA The current can be increased / decreased with 
incrementing or decrementing the numbers and is directly active. Press ENTER to store the new 
value. 
Remark: the analog output value can be programmed “up-side-down” if desired, so 20mA at mini-
mum flowrate for example! 

TUNE MAX / 20MA 
6.4 

The initial maximum analog output value is 20mA. However, this value might differ slightly due to 
external influences such as temperature  for example. The 20mA value can be tuned precisely with 
this setting. 

Before tuning the signal, be sure that the analog signal is not being used for any 

application! 

After pressing PROG, the current will be about 20mA. The current can be increased / decreased 
with incrementing or decrementing the numbers and is directly active. Press ENTER to store the 
new value. 
Remark: the analog output value can be programmed “up-side-down” if desired, so 4mA at maxi-
mum flow rate for example!
